我有一个网页,显示使用C3.js的图表。数据来源是网址。现在我想添加引导日期时间选择器的功能,以便我可以在特定时间戳之后查询数据。选择日期并提交日期。应更改源URL,它应包含时间戳的查询参数。 这可能与C3.js,刷新源URL。 我怎样才能做到这一点?
答案 0 :(得分:1)
您可以使用.load();
API函数刷新图表。看实况示例here
应该看起来像:
var chart = c3.generate({
data: {
url: '/data/c3_test.csv'
}
});
//later in the code
//#timestamp is your datetime picker element
$('#timestamp').on('change', function(){
chart.load({
url: '/data/c3_test2.csv'
});
});